Turbocharged Engine Improves Driving Performance
One of the biggest highlights of the 2026 Punch Facelift is the expected addition of a 1.2 litre turbo petrol engine. This engine is likely to deliver improved power output compared to the standard naturally aspirated version. With an estimated power output close to 120 PS and strong torque performance, the turbocharged setup is expected to make the vehicle more responsive in both city and highway conditions.
The engine is expected to be paired with a manual transmission, offering smooth gear shifts and improved driving control. The additional power will make overtaking easier and provide better acceleration during daily driving. The turbo engine option also makes the Punch more appealing to buyers who want a fun and energetic driving experience.

Enhanced Safety Features For Everyday Protection
Safety remains a key focus area for Tata Motors, and the 2026 Punch Facelift is expected to include multiple safety upgrades. Standard safety equipment may include six airbags, anti-lock braking system with electronic brake distribution, and electronic stability control. These features help improve driver confidence and passenger protection during emergency situations.
The vehicle may also offer a 360 degree camera system to assist with parking and tight maneuvering. Some higher variants are expected to include advanced driver assistance features such as lane departure warning and automatic emergency braking. These additions make the Punch one of the safer choices in the micro SUV segment.

Expected Fuel Efficiency And Running Cost Advantage
Fuel efficiency continues to be an important factor for Indian car buyers. The 2026 Punch Facelift with the turbo petrol engine is expected to deliver mileage close to 20 kilometers per litre, depending on driving conditions. While the turbo setup focuses on improving performance, Tata Motors is expected to maintain competitive fuel economy.
Lower running costs and improved engine efficiency make the Punch a practical option for daily users. The vehicle is expected to provide a good balance between performance and fuel savings, making it suitable for budget-conscious buyers.
Competitive Pricing That Strengthens Market Position
The 2026 Tata Punch Facelift is expected to start at around ₹7.5 lakh in India. This pricing places it in a competitive position within the micro SUV category. Depending on the variant and features, the price range may extend to higher levels for fully loaded trims.
